It's most likely just an ordinary virus/germ.. Sore throat, nausea, headaches and tiredness are common symptoms for being "sick" in general (it could be many things). You'll probably be over it soon. Meanwhile, drink lots of fluids and don't eat anything weird that could make you nauseous. More rest helps, so try to get as much sleep as you can (again). Over-the-counter drugs will help some of your symptoms (but make sure you know what you're doing first-- sometimes they can make you worse).
If you don't feel progressively better after about a week, or worse symptoms develop, then you should go to the doctor. ]
